| Hi Tech Gurus, I have a "vxfs" filesystem mounted on a logical volume on HP-UX 11.11 system. I want to take a snapshot at lvm level. In order to have a consistent copy of data in the snapshot volume I do quiesce (FREEZE the file system) on the file system and then run lvsplit command. This execution hangs. Is someone aware of what the problem could be and whats the solution or workaround for this. Pls reply ASAP. Any help on this is highly appreciated. Thanks & regards, Gary Bond. |
